636426990191 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 636426990192. Its totient is φ = 636426990190.

The previous prime is 636426990119. The next prime is 636426990203. The reversal of 636426990191 is 191099624636.

Together with previous prime (636426990119) it forms an Ormiston pair, because they use the same digits, order apart.

It is a strong prime.

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 636426990191 - 210 = 636426989167 is a prime.

It is a super-4 number, since 4×6364269901914 (a number of 48 digits) contains 4444 as substring. Note that it is a super-d number also for d = 3.

It is a congruent number.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(636426990691) by changing a digit.

It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(17) of ones.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 318213495095 + 318213495096.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(318213495096).

Almost surely, 2636426990191 is an apocalyptic number.

636426990191 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).

636426990191 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.

636426990191 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.

The product of its (nonzero) digits is 3779136, while the sum is 56.
